Originally chi referred to air, because it was through that your blood vessels carried air rather than blood and that this was your life-force. The main reason for the was because dissection was very much frowned upon, except for criminals who were almost always beheaded. The pressure in a beheading allows the blood to pump out, leaving what seem to be empty blood vessels. Even when it was discovered that they did carry blood the theory was adapted so that the veins carried blood and the arteries carried air.

Sounds a lot like the flat Earth theory to me.
